Description
Connect your MSA compliant 40GbE QSFP+ network devices with this cost-effective, passive Twinax copper cable. This 40G QSFP+ cable delivers what you need most in your network connections: reliable performance. It's built to MSA specifications and fully tested to ensure seamless compatibility.
This passive twinaxial cable is a fully hot-pluggable, direct-attach cable, supporting 40 Gigabit Ethernet applications connected through QSFP+ (Quad Small Form-Factor Pluggable) ports.
Designed for short-length, high-speed interconnects, this low-power, low-latency Twinax cable is a cost-effective alternative to fiber-optic cable assemblies, supporting short-distance applications such as point-to-point in-rack network switch or server connections.
